About Parliament
The Parliament of Guyana was created by the 1966 Constitution of Guyana, embodied in the Schedule of the Guyana Independence Order, made pursuant to the Guyana Independence Act, 1966. The Guyana Independence Act was passed on 12th May, 1966 and came into force on 26th May, 1966.
